Utilities and wifi are included in Smyth Hall housing costs. Free laundry facilities are also available. 
The Loras Meal Plan is also included in Smyth Hall housing costs. This plan includes $300 Duhawk Dollars per semester ($600 per year) to be used in the Loras Café, The Pub, The Duhawk Market, event concessions, or Einstein Brothers Bagels when fall/spring classes are in session. This plan will carry forward from fall to spring semester during the academic year as long as you continue to be enrolled as a student. The Duhawk Dollars are not transferrable from one student to another and any unused balance is nontransferable.

Tuition and fees listed are subject to change.

Rates effective for the Summer 2022 term through the Spring 2023 term
Graduate and Professional Education coursework are offered across fall, spring, and summer terms. Tuition and Fees do not vary across terms. Credit hour rates/fees are reviewed each spring and increases take effect in the summer term.
